Lando Norris won the Austrian Grand Prix from pole position in a McLaren one-two on Sunday after fending off championship-leading team mate Oscar Piastri in an early wheel-to-wheel duel and then withstanding intense pressure to the end. The Briton’s third victory of the season cut Australian Piastri’s Formula One lead from 22 to 15 points after 11 of 24 rounds, with the two McLaren drivers locked in an increasingly private title battle. Charles Leclerc completed the podium for Ferrari with teammate Lewis Hamilton fourth and George Russell, last year’s winner in Austria, fifth for Mercedes. Red Bull’s four-time world champion Max Verstappen suffered his first retirement of the season, in his team’s home race, after a first-lap collision with Mercedes’s Italian rookie Kimi Antonelli.
